summaryrefslogtreecommitdiffstats
path: root/weaver
diff options
context:
space:
mode:
authoraclement <aclement>2008-06-11 19:40:30 +0000
committeraclement <aclement>2008-06-11 19:40:30 +0000
commit06f056227ea78ef424f9c5baf91148d208ff3df8 (patch)
tree3ab36b896f3c51bba5dab42e257fe086ba34d00b /weaver
parenta0cf51dde7d399fbf7774df4709c19b8a7e95b4a (diff)
downloadaspectj-06f056227ea78ef424f9c5baf91148d208ff3df8.tar.gz
aspectj-06f056227ea78ef424f9c5baf91148d208ff3df8.zip
197719: second testcase
Diffstat (limited to 'weaver')
-rw-r--r--weaver/src/org/aspectj/weaver/bcel/BcelShadow.java2
1 files changed, 0 insertions, 2 deletions
diff --git a/weaver/src/org/aspectj/weaver/bcel/BcelShadow.java b/weaver/src/org/aspectj/weaver/bcel/BcelShadow.java
index dbf68b730..ae3bd53fd 100644
--- a/weaver/src/org/aspectj/weaver/bcel/BcelShadow.java
+++ b/weaver/src/org/aspectj/weaver/bcel/BcelShadow.java
@@ -3456,8 +3456,6 @@ public class BcelShadow extends Shadow {
if (!hasThis()) { // pr197719 - static accessor has been created to handle the call
if (Modifier.isStatic(enclosingMethod.getAccessFlags()) && enclosingMethod.getName().startsWith("access$")) {
targetType = BcelWorld.fromBcel(enclosingMethod.getArgumentTypes()[0]);
- } else {
- throw new BCException("unexpectedly found static context at shadow "+toString()+": accessor method involved?");
}
} else {
if (!targetType.resolve(world).isAssignableFrom(getThisType().resolve(world))) {